"Fideles" is a fascinating Latin word that often appears in crosswords, challenging solvers with its nuanced meaning. Derived from "fidelis," meaning faithful or loyal, "fideles" is the plural form, translating to "the faithful ones" or "the loyal ones." This term carries significant weight, particularly in historical, literary, and religious contexts.

Understanding the root of "fideles" helps in deciphering related English words like fidelity, fiduciary, and infidel. What does 'fideles' mean in Latin?

'Fideles' is a Latin word. It is the plural form of 'fidelis', meaning 'faithful', 'loyal', or 'trustworthy'. So, 'fideles' collectively refers to 'the faithful ones' or 'the loyal ones'.

Are there different contexts where 'fideles' is used?

Yes, 'fideles' can be found in various contexts. Historically, it might refer to loyal subjects or adherents. In a religious context, it often refers to members of a religious community or 'the faithful'.
